Stafford firm takes first EC140E

Following its launch at this year’s Plantworx exhibition in June, the first fourteen-tonne Volvo EC140 E series machine has been delivered to Stafford-based LRD Plant Hire Ltd.

LRD specialises in the construction of concrete flooring for large industrial and agricultural buildings along with the associated works for ground preparation.

Looking to add another machine to his fleet, owner Lindsey Dickin had the opportunity to operate the larger EC220E at a Volvo open day event earlier in the year. “I was particularly impressed with the controllability and gradeability of the machine,” says Mr Dickin. “These features are very important for the work we undertake in getting the groundwork absolutely correct and level prior to laying concrete. Since it was time to add another machine to my fleet and having run Volvo excavators for the last eight years I was happy to stick with what I know best so opted for the new EC140E.”
